F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- CHAPTER 2M F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- LONG TITLE Empowering section VerDate:30/06/1997 (Cap 2, section 17C) [27 October 1994] (L.N. 515 of 1994) F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- SECT 1 (Omitted as spent) VerDate:30/06/1997 (Omitted as spent) (Enacted 1994) F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- SECT 2 Fees for official signatures, etc. VerDate:30/06/1997 The fees set out in column 3 of the Schedule shall be charged for the signatures and miscellaneous services set out in column 2 of the Schedule. (Enacted 1994) F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- SECT 3 Power to reduce, waive or refund fees VerDate:30/06/1997 The Financial Secretary may, in any case or class of case, reduce, waive or refund the whole or any part of any fee payable under this Notice. (Enacted 1994) FEES FOR OFFICIAL SIGNATURES AND MISCELLANEOUS SERVICES NOTICE - SCHEDULE SCHEDULE VerDate:12/01/2001 [section 2] Item Signature or service Fee$ 1. Fees for signatures of- (a) the Chief Executive 260 (b) the Chief Secretary for Administration 220 (c) the Financial Secretary 220 2. The issue of a duplicate of any document by a public officer 140 3. Any alteration, transfer or endorsement of or addition to a document by a public officer 140 4. The certification of a true extract of any document, book, record or instrument by a public officer 140 (Enacted 1994.
